There’s no question that Samsung is the first company that comes to mind when talking about foldable phones, and that’s because the Korean company has been teasing this new form factor for several years. An increasing number of reports said some three years ago that Samsung was getting ready to launch a foldable phone, but Samsung kept delaying it. The handset is finally hitting stores in 2019, but Samsung will have plenty of competition from several major Chinese smartphone makers, including Huawei and Xiaomi.

Apple, meanwhile, has been working on its own foldable devices for quite a while, although, as with any other Apple project, the foldable iPhone is very secret. Nonetheless, there’s plenty of evidence to support the idea that Apple is interested in foldable devices, and we just got even more proof that such a handset may be in the making.
